i want to insert a led so when i turn the x0x on the led will light on, and that make the LED brighter the higher the note playes..
This could be done in the microcontroller. I believe (but am not sure) that there are a couple of spare pins that could be used for this. Then its a matter of hacking the firmware to spit out a PWM signal proportional to the note being played and solid signal when the sequencer is stopped. Sokkan would be able to say 1) how much work this would be and 2) if there's room for the code for such a mod.

I would just take the signal from the CV-out jack(0-5V, proportional to what note is played), buffer it, and drive a LED with it. You might need some sort of bias or whatever, but it should not be that hard.
